Historically speaking , wheel are a much newer development than you might expect . The old go back specimen is a wooden Slovenian model built sometime between5,100 and 5,350 years ago . By then , humans had already been practicing husbandry for several millenary — in fact , farming may date all the way back to12,000 BCE.Canoesandanimal domesticationalso immensely predate the wheel .
Why did this invention take so long to get wind ? Well , from a vehicular standpoint , spinning wheels are basically useless unless they ’re attached to a secure shaft of some sorting . It was only after human race finally built such stabilizers — which we now call “ axles”—that the wheel get recognise its full potential difference . “ The bike - and - axle construct was the real fortuity of brilliance,”saysanthropologistDavid Anthony . That idea require extreme finesse , which only metal tools could adequately leave . However , these did n’t become widespread until around 4000 BCE , hence our delay .
Slovenia ’s aforementionedartifactemerged from the Ljubljana Marshes back in 2002 . With a 27.5 - inch radius , it was presumably one of two wheel affixed to an ancient cart . Yet , impressive as the relic is , aPolish stack — made anywhere from 5650 to 5385 year ago — upstages it . adumbrate upon this container is a raw wagon , thought by many to be the first artistic word-painting of wheeled expatriation .

Back in those days , Northern Europe was populated by what archaeologists call “ The Funnel Beaker Culture . ” Sophisticatedagriculturalists , these people just might have been the first to construct true wheels . Other candidates include the Mesopotamians and the for the most part - sedentaryCucuteni - Tripolyeculture . That latter group built small , four - wheeledtoysin modern - day Ukraine , Moldova , and Romania .
at long last , it ’s possible that many groups severally invented the wheel . Ancient Mesoamericans , for object lesson , alsoproduced petty wheeled statuette despite having no eff contact with their old Earth counterparts . However , thewestern hemispheresuffered from a near - total lack of tameness - ready animal open of pull in carts . Thus , full - sized wheels do n’t look to have become popular on either American continent before overseas invaders started read up .
